Before choosing a DZ visit and check it out. Pack a lunch and a lawn chair. Check out the vibes. Is The DZ a happy like pops describe's or do You feel like you walked into a used car lot .

Hanging out and checking the vibes is free and could save you time and $$$ in the long run. Tell tale signs of a DZ I would stay away from, to many Tandems, to many solos, students that don't know how to pack, and to many cute babes that are on the fast track, poor service, a crappy looking plane.

You won't know the difference between a student friendly DZ and a used car lot until you look around. and kick the tires.
